I took an old piece of Masonite board...

on the smooth side I painted it blue...

forget the goofy dolphins and weird design...

just watch how he makes the clouds...

got to the 1:14 mark...

I'm just doing a blue sky with clouds...

3 colors...

painted blue...mist of gray...clouds white...

they look pretty good and seem pretty easy...
